org.deegree_impl.services.wfs.configuration
Class Connection_Impl

java.lang.Object
  extended byorg.deegree_impl.services.wfs.configuration.Connection_Impl
All Implemented Interfaces:
Connection

public class Connection_Impl
extends java.lang.Object
implements Connection

The interface describes the connection to a database

---------------------------------------------------------------------

Version:
$Revision: 1.4 $ $Date: 2004/04/02 06:41:56 $
Author:
Andreas Poth

Field Summary
private  java.lang.String driver
           
private  java.lang.String logon
           
private  java.lang.String password
           
private  java.lang.String sdeDatabase
           
private  java.lang.String spatialVersion
           
private  java.lang.String user
           
 
Constructor Summary
(package private) Connection_Impl(java.lang.String driver, java.lang.String logon, java.lang.String user, java.lang.String password)
          Creates a new Connection_Impl object.
 
Method Summary
 java.lang.String getDriver()
          returns the name of the jdbc driver class
 java.lang.String getLogon()
          returns the logon (address, port etc.) to a database
 java.lang.String getPassword()
          returns the users's password
 java.lang.String getSDEDatabase()
          returns the name of the sde database that is assigned to a SDE connection.
 java.lang.String getSpatialVersion()
          returns the version number of the spatial extension if an Oracle Spatial database is used.
 java.lang.String getUser()
          returns the name of the user who shall be used for connecting a database
 void setDriver(java.lang.String driver)
           
 void setLogon(java.lang.String logon)
           
 void setPassword(java.lang.String password)
           
 void setSDEDatabase(java.lang.String sdeDatabase)
           
 void setSpatialVersion(java.lang.String spatialVersion)
           
 void setUser(java.lang.String user)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

driver

private java.lang.String driver

logon

private java.lang.String logon

password

private java.lang.String password

sdeDatabase

private java.lang.String sdeDatabase

spatialVersion

private java.lang.String spatialVersion

user

private java.lang.String user
Constructor Detail

Connection_Impl

Connection_Impl(java.lang.String driver,
                java.lang.String logon,
                java.lang.String user,
                java.lang.String password)
Creates a new Connection_Impl object.

Parameters:
driver -
logon -
user -
password -
Method Detail

getDriver

public java.lang.String getDriver()
returns the name of the jdbc driver class

Specified by:
getDriver in interface Connection

setDriver

public void setDriver(java.lang.String driver)
See Also:
getDriver()

getLogon

public java.lang.String getLogon()
returns the logon (address, port etc.) to a database

Specified by:
getLogon in interface Connection

setLogon

public void setLogon(java.lang.String logon)
See Also:
getLogon()

getUser

public java.lang.String getUser()
returns the name of the user who shall be used for connecting a database

Specified by:
getUser in interface Connection
Returns:
user name or an empty string is no user shall be used

setUser

public void setUser(java.lang.String user)
See Also:
getUser()

getPassword

public java.lang.String getPassword()
returns the users's password

Specified by:
getPassword in interface Connection
Returns:
password or an empty string is no password shall be used

setPassword

public void setPassword(java.lang.String password)
See Also:
getPassword()

getSpatialVersion

public java.lang.String getSpatialVersion()
returns the version number of the spatial extension if an Oracle Spatial database is used.

Specified by:
getSpatialVersion in interface Connection

setSpatialVersion

public void setSpatialVersion(java.lang.String spatialVersion)
See Also:
getSpatialVersion()

getSDEDatabase

public java.lang.String getSDEDatabase()
returns the name of the sde database that is assigned to a SDE connection.

Specified by:
getSDEDatabase in interface Connection

setSDEDatabase

public void setSDEDatabase(java.lang.String sdeDatabase)
See Also:
getSDEDatabase()